Transferability of Shares. Until the Vesting Date described below, the Shares may not be sold, assigned, transferred, pledged, hypothecated or otherwise disposed of (whether by operation of law or otherwise) nor shall the Shares be subject to execution, attachment or similar process, except that the Shares may be transferred by will or the laws of descent and distribution or, upon notice to Staples, for estate planning purposes to entities that are beneficially owned entirely by family members. All transferees of the Shares must agree to be governed by all of the terms and conditions of this Agreement. Upon any sale, transfer, assignment, pledge, hypothecation or other disposition, or any attempt to sell, assign, transfer, pledge, hypothecate or otherwise dispose, of the Shares contrary to the provisions hereof, or upon the levy of any execution, attachment or similar process upon the Shares or such rights, the Shares shall, at the election of Staples, be deemed repurchased by Staples at a repurchase price of zero and all rights with respect to the Shares shall be forfeited to Staples. In addition, Staples may seek any other legal or equitable remedies available to it, including rights of specific performance. Staples may refuse to recognize as a shareholder of Staples any purported transferee of or holder of any rights with respect to the Shares and may retain and/or recover all dividends payable or paid with respect to such Shares.

Transferability of Shares. Any Shares issued or transferred to the Participant pursuant to the Award shall be subject to such stop transfer orders and other restrictions as the Administrator may deem advisable under the Plan, the Notice, these Terms and Conditions or the rules, regulations and other requirements of the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ission, any stock exchange upon which such Shares are listed, and any applicable federal or state laws or relevant securities laws of the jurisdiction of the domicile of the Participant, and the Administrator may cause a legend or legends to be put on any certificates representing such Shares or make an appropriate entry on the record books of the appropriate registered book-entry custodian, if the Shares are not certificated, to make appropriate reference to such restrictions.
Transferability of Shares. Grantee may not offer, sell, or otherwise dispose of any Restricted Stock in a way which would: (i) require the Company to file any registration statement with the Securities and Exchange Commission (or any similar filing under state law or the laws of any other country) or to amend or supplement any such filing or (ii) violate or cause the Company to violate the Securities Act of 1933, as amended, the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, as amended, the rules and regulations promulgated thereunder, any other state or federal law, or the laws of any other country. The Company reserves the right to place restrictions on the Restricted Stock received by Grantee pursuant to this Award.

Transferability of Shares. Following exercise of the Option and issuance of Shares, in the event the Company permits the Participant to arrange for sale of Shares through a broker or another designated agent of the Company, the Participant acknowledges and agrees that the Company may block any such sale and/or cancel any order to sell placed by the Participant, in each case if the Participant is not then permitted under the Company’s xxxxxxx xxxxxxx policy to engage in transactions with respect to securities of the Company. If the Committee determines that the ability of the Participant to sell or transfer Shares is restricted, then the Company may place a restrictive legend or stop transfer notation on any certificate that may be issued to represent such Shares or on its books with respect to such Shares. If a legend or stop transfer notation is placed on any certificate or the Company’s books with respect to the Participant’s Shares, the Participant may only sell such Shares in compliance with such legend or notation.
